PostgrelSQL清除WAL日志

2023-11-13

1. 查看当前日志回写情况

pg_controldata

pg_control version number: 1300
Catalog version number: 202007201
Database system identifier: 6978101400539662106
Database cluster state: in production
pg_control last modified: Fri 06 May 2022 09:09:01 AM CST
Latest checkpoint location: 121F/BBC01308
Latest checkpoint’s REDO location: 121F/BA94EF20
Latest checkpoint’s REDO WAL file: 000000010000121F000000BA
Latest checkpoint’s TimeLineID: 1
Latest checkpoint’s PrevTimeLineID: 1
Latest checkpoint’s full_page_writes: on
Latest checkpoint’s NextXID: 0:3354007421
Latest checkpoint’s NextOID: 2251155
Latest checkpoint’s NextMultiXactId: 1
Latest checkpoint’s NextMultiOffset: 0
Latest checkpoint’s oldestXID: 3157544777
Latest checkpoint’s oldestXID’s DB: 14174
Latest checkpoint’s oldestActiveXID: 3354007411
Latest checkpoint’s oldestMultiXid: 1
Latest checkpoint’s oldestMulti’s DB: 14174
Latest checkpoint’s oldestCommitTsXid:0
Latest checkpoint’s newestCommitTsXid:0
Time of latest checkpoint: Fri 06 May 2022 09:08:47 AM CST
Fake LSN counter for unlogged rels: 0/3E8
Minimum recovery ending location: 0/0
Min recovery ending loc’s timeline: 0
Backup start location: 0/0
Backup end location: 0/0
End-of-backup record required: no
wal_level setting: replica
wal_log_hints setting: on
max_connections setting: 1000
max_worker_processes setting: 8
max_wal_senders setting: 10
max_prepared_xacts setting: 0
max_locks_per_xact setting: 1024
track_commit_timestamp setting: off
Maximum data alignment: 8
Database block size: 8192
Blocks per segment of large relation: 131072
WAL block size: 8192
Bytes per WAL segment: 16777216
Maximum length of identifiers: 64
Maximum columns in an index: 32
Maximum size of a TOAST chunk: 1996
Size of a large-object chunk: 2048
Date/time type storage: 64-bit integers
Float8 argument passing: by value
Data page checksum version: 0
Mock authentication nonce: ffc376c6b9c85d47e306f8541e9dfc94437d4a1a2df4d533c24ebb674355e194
[root@db1 data]#

记下 Latest checkpoint’s REDO WAL file的值:000000010000121F000000BA

2. 清除归档文件

pg_archivecleanup -d "/data/archivedir/" 000000010000121F000000BA

3. 清除日志文件

pg_archivecleanup -d "/data/pgsql/pg_wal/" 000000010000121F000000BA
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

PostgrelSQL清除WAL日志 的相关文章

  • 保持服务器和客户端之间的验证逻辑同步[关闭]

    Closed 这个问题是基于意见的 help closed questions 目前不接受答案 In my 上一个问题 https stackoverflow com questions 39371 database exception h
  • 处理续集迁移和初始化的工作流程?

    我不明白续集迁移工作流程是如何工作的 我有一个新建项目 数据库是使用 SQL 脚本设计的 我们用了sequelize auto之后生成模型 我现在需要生成一个迁移文件 以便我可以运行 CLI 来运行 SQL 查询 为本地配置的数据库创建包含
  • Postgresql - 如何获取表中与另一个表不匹配的条目

    我有一个问题 但我真的不知道如何问 请多多包涵 SELECT sc scd siteid scd desc frontend FROM shipping code sc LEFT OUTER JOIN shipping code descr
  • 关闭准备好的语句

    使用PreparedStatements 和ResultSets 是否会在每次使用时创建一个 新的数据库实例 或者 换句话说 如果我使用PreparedStatement和ResultSet 我应该在每次使用后或完成后关闭它们吗 Examp
  • 数据库设计 - 类别和子类别[关闭]

    Closed 这个问题是基于意见的 help closed questions 目前不接受答案 我需要在类似于黄金页面的东西上实现分类和子分类 假设我有下表 类别表 CategoryId Title 10 Home 20 Business
  • 如何在Postgresql时间戳中存储Golang time.time?

    我可以知道如何存储time timePostgresql 中的对象 例如 SQL 查询 INSERT INTO UserAccount email login time VALUES email protected cdn cgi l em
  • 按钮 Onclick 调用 Javascript,后者调用 PHP 文件,该文件添加到 Mysql 数据库

    我需要添加到数据库的帮助 我想从按钮单击方法调用 javascript scrt Javascript 脚本 我想调用一个 php 文件 其中包含一些添加到 MySQL 数据库的代码 我确实尝试了 20 多个网站 但没有任何帮助 如果 AJ
  • psql 的备用输出格式显示每行一列以及列名

    我在 Ubuntu 上使用 PostgreSQL 8 4 我有一个带有列的表格c1通过cN 这些列足够宽 选择所有列会导致一行查询结果多次换行 因此 输出很难阅读 当查询结果仅包含几行时 如果我可以查看查询结果 使得每行的每一列都位于单独的
  • 在 REDIS+RABBITMQ+Celery 中访问 Postgres DB 会使用“信号 11 (SIGSEGV) 终止 Python 任务”

    当我们运行 SQL 命令时 例如 video Video objects get pk 1 在Python视图中 它工作没有任何问题 然而 如果在定义为 celery 的方法中启动 shared task 它死了并杀死了PythonERRO
  • 在 Mac 上通过 Homebrew 安装 PostgreSQL 时出错

    在 Mac OSX 10 11 6 上通过 Homebrew 安装 PostgreSQL 时 出现以下错误 Error The brew link step did not complete successfully The formula
  • rspec 返回“PG::Error: ERROR: 关系“table_name”不存在”

    rvm rspec 2 8 0 rails 3 0 6 和 pg 0 13 2 上的环境为 REE 2011 12 在 CentOS 5 6 上使用 PostgreSQL 8 3 17 db migrate 可以正常工作 但 rspec 出
  • 我应该对表进行分区/子分区吗?

    Case 系统有dispositives 基本上由id type name 我可能有N个dispositives 我有一张桌子来存放log of all dispositives 这是系统中最大的表 现在统计100英里记录 The log表
  • c3p0 连接检查

    我第一次尝试使用 c3p0 实现解决方案 我了解如何初始化连接池并从池中 签出 连接 如下所示 ComboPooledDataSource cpds new ComboPooledDataSource cpds setDriverClass
  • 当 SQL 包含变量时在 pgAdmin 中调试 SQL

    在 SQL Server 中 我可以从应用程序中复制 sql 代码并将其粘贴到 SSMS 中 声明并分配 sql 中存在的变量并运行 是的 很棒的调试场景 例如 请注意 我很生疏 语法可能不正确 declare x as varchar 1
  • 为 Couch Base Server 1.8 和 2.0 构建 Erlang 客户端

    我们已经用过沙发基地服务器 http www couchbase com 在我们的产品中 它是一个内联网应用程序 其前端是纯JavaScript 然而我们使用Erlang OTP http erlang org对于业务逻辑 身份验证 Mne
  • 我是否应该标准化我的数据库?

    在设计数据库 例如 MySQL 的模式时 会出现是否完全规范化表的问题 一方面 连接 以及外键约束等 非常慢 另一方面 您会获得冗余数据和潜在的不一致 最后优化 是正确的方法吗 即创建一个按书本规范化的数据库 然后查看可以对哪些内容进行非规
  • 半透明数据库

    我正在构建一个包含健康信息的应用程序 这个面向消费者的应用程序对我来说是新的 我想要一种方法来完全消除隐私问题 当我回顾保护可公开访问的数据库中的敏感数据的方法时 我经常遇到数据库半透明的概念 有原书 http www wayner org
  • 浏览器关闭后从数据库中删除

    我正在开发一个电子商务应用程序 但问题是 当用户将产品添加到购物车并在订购前关闭浏览器时 购物车会带走所有产品 所有购物车项目都保存在表中 如果用户关闭浏览器而不订购 我只想刷新购物车 您可以使用 Javascript 事件捕获浏览器关闭并
  • PostgreSQL、Npgsql 返回 42601:“$1”处或附近的语法错误

    我正在尝试使用 Npgsql 和 或 Dapper 来查询表 但我不断遇到Npgsql PostgresException 42601 syntax error at or near 1 这是我用 NpgsqlCommand 尝试的结果 u
  • SQL Server:比较两个表中的列

    我最近完成了从某些应用程序的旧版本到当前版本的迁移 在迁移数据库时遇到了一些问题 我需要一个可以帮助我比较两个表中的列的查询 我的意思不是行中的数据 我需要比较列本身来弄清楚我错过了表结构的哪些变化 看一下红门 SQL 比较 http ww

随机推荐

  • 很火的AI换脸怎么做的?方法其实非常简单

    网上很火的AI换脸是怎么做到的呢 将自己的脸部特征换到名人照片中 可以让我们看到自己和名人的组合效果如何 还可以将自己的脸部特征换到历史人物的照片中 看看自己是否有历史人物的气质 这种操作也非常有趣 看看自己是否适应不同的文化氛围 这也是一
  • 参加CSDN第六期编程竞赛感想

    CSDN编程竞赛报名地址 https edu csdn net contest detail 16 请不要删掉此地址 前言 背景 个人虽已经在IT行业工作多年 算法上是小白 没有多少积累 为了学习进步 自我提升 偶然机会看到CSDN举行的第
  • kubernetes 安装dns组件

    DNS 组件历史版本有skydns kube dns和coredns三个 k8s1 3版本之前使用skydns 之后的版本到1 17及之间的版本使用kube dns 目前主要使用coredns DNS组件用于解析k8s集群中service
  • excel+power query进行文本数据拆分和提取

    我的博客之前分享了pandas中文本数据的拆分和提取 由于数据量不大 我们也可以使用excel和它自带的插件power query进行同样的处理 原始数据如下 数据来源见此贴 登录爬取拉勾网2 0 Python selenium 数据准备
  • Python编程:安装自己编写的包

    前言 最近在跑人群计数代码时 有一些自己经常用到的代码 每次要用时再写一次总是很麻烦 所以想着把这部分常用的代码封装成库 以便于随时随地使用 做法 这里使用一种简易的方式 直接将自己编写的代码文件夹复制到python能够搜索到的位置 首先在
  • make -C $(LINUX_KERNEL_PATH) M=$(PWD) modules中的M选项

    新的内核模块编程中的make命令里有个M选项 如下 make C lib modules shell uname r build M PWD modules M PWD 意思是返回到当前目录继续读入 执行当前的Makefile 请参考 从
  • 软件、硬件版本号命名规范

    软件 硬件版本号命名规范 常见版本号规范示例如 v1 0 0 通用版本命名规范如下 主版本号 子版本号 修订版本号 日期 版本阶段 如v1 2 3 20201228 rc 主版本号 1 功能模块发生较大变动 如增加多个模块 整体架构改变 子
  • Linux基础篇大集合

    目录 一 基础篇 一 基本常识 1 linux的三种网络连接方式 2 虚拟机的克隆 3 虚拟机的快照 4 虚拟机的迁移和删除 二 目录结构 三 基本实操 1 远程连接Linux操作系统 2 vi vim编辑器 3 Linux关机重启 4 用
  • react+react-router 4.0+redux+antd 购物车实战项目

    前言 前些日子抽空学习了下react 因为近期忙着找工作 没时间写博客 今天我们就来看看用react全家桶 构建一个项目把 可能我学的也不是特别好 但是经过各种查资料 总算是能够构建出一个像模像样的栗子了 github地址 https gi
  • c++开发框架Qt6:构建系统CMake详解

    Qt自带集成开发环境 IDE 名为Qt Creator 它可以在Linux OS X和Windows上运行 并提供智能代码完成 语法高亮 集成帮助系统 调试器和剖析器集成 还集成了所有主要的版本控制系统 如git Bazaar 除了Qt C
  • 台式电脑显示配置100%请勿关闭计算机,Win7关机提示“配置Windows Update已完成30%请勿关闭计算机”怎么解决...

    重装了Win7旗舰版系统后 每次关机的时候桌面上都会显示一个 配置Windows Update的界面 提示请勿关闭计算机 每次停留好几分钟才能正常关机 导致什么情况引起的呢 出现配置Windows Update是因为系统开启了自动更新功能
  • 基于Vue的Excel文件预览(使用LuckyExcel、LuckySheet实现)

    目录 一 介绍 二 基本思路 三 安装 Luckyexcel Luckysheet CDN引入 本地引入 四 具体实现 1 首先需要一个页面 用于excel的预览展示 2 编写Excel解析渲染函数 openExcel url链接 文件名
  • Flutter 基础(五)Route 路由以及页面间传值

    Route 路由以及页面间传值 一种页面跳转机制 路由 Route 对应到 Android 就是 Intent Flutter 路由分两种 新建路由 注册路由 需要Route表示 Navigator进行管理 跳转页面 Navigator p
  • 区块链与征信

    1 为什么要将区块链应用在征信上 1 1 中国征信产业发展现状 图1 中国征信产业发展现状 1 2 区块链征信的可行性分析 首先 从个人层面来说 区块链能帮助我们确立自身的数据主权 生成自己的信用资产 这是个人信用生产的基础 也是我们将来的
  • 各种动态规划算法的C语言

    以下是常见的几种动态规划算法的C语言实例 01背包问题 include
  • ftp用户只能ftp

    test用户 usermod s sbin nologin test 锁定telnet usermod s bin bash test 解锁
  • 【深度学习】动手学深度学习——编码器-解码器

    参考资料 https zh d2l ai chapter recurrent modern encoder decoder html 1 深度学习简介 核心思想 用数据编程 机器学习 寻找适用不同问题的函数形式 以及如何使用数据来获取函数的
  • discuz访问手机端跳转到PC端

    discuz访问手机端跳转到PC端 博主描述下遇到的问题 后台手机访问设置中手机端已开启 但手机端访问时却不能跳转到手机端 有些页面链接加上参数mobile 2才可以 对此 查看下 后台 手机访问设置 中以下两项是否打开 记得开启手机浏览器
  • Python从txt文件中提取特定数据

    本段代码用于 想要从一段txt文件中只提取目标数据的情况 代码 def get data txt path str epoch int 100 target str target data len int 5 num list 将提取出来的
  • PostgrelSQL清除WAL日志

    1 查看当前日志回写情况 pg controldata pg control version number 1300 Catalog version number 202007201 Database system identifier 6